American Idol 2010

The highly anticipated ninth season of “American Idol” is almost here. It will be premiering on prime time Fox on January 12, 2010. All of the judges including Simon Cowell, Randy Jackson, and Kara DioGuardi will be returning with a surprising fourth addition, Ellen DeGeneres.

Auditions were held in cities all over the country as usual. These cities include Foxborough, Atalnta, Chicago, Arlington, Los Angeles, Orlando, and Denver.

Along with American Idol, “Idol Gives Back” will also be returning this season. It will be held on April 21st during the top seven results show. Of course the top 24 semi-finalists format will be making its return as well.

As you can see, the premier of “American Idol” is one of the most anticipated TV series of 2010. Ever since its debut in 2002, the show has exploded as a respected and entertaining reality TV show with substance.

Gossip Girl

“Good morning Upper East Siders, Gossip Girl here, you’re one and only guide to Manhattan’s elite.” The quote that started it all. Gossip Girl is a television series based from the book of the same name.

It is also obvious that Gossip Girl’s target audience is for girls but even guys get hooked.  Basically the show is mostly about a group of teenagers aged around 14-18 who attend a rather elite high school, St Jude’s, which is based in New York’s Upper East Side. Gossip Girl is a narrator, who is unseen during season 1 and so far in season 2.

Within the main characters there are various relationships – Blair and Nate are portrayed as the perfect society couple at the start of the season but as the season progresses we see there are many cracks in their relationship, including a naughty encounter Nate has with Serena just before her self-imposed exile. Serena is determined not to rekindle their fling on her return as she is Blair’s best friend and was the “Queen” before she ran away and Blair assumed that particular position in the school “gang”. Then Serena and Dan fall for each other, a relationship which is highly discouraged by her best friend Blair who treats Dan like something she stepped on and is made more complicated by the fact that Serena’s mother and Dan’s father were once lovers.

The Oprah Winfrey Show Finale

The Oprah show has been a mainstay in many lives throughout the years. Many people have enjoyed watching her on television and her many other programs that are on the air and in print. Many people have faithfully watched her show for many years almost twenty five to be exact. Unfortunately in late 2009 Oprah Winfrey announced that her hit talk show of many years will end in 2011.

Winfrey told the audience that she loved “The Oprah Winfrey Show,” that it had been her life and that she knew when it was time to say goodbye. “Twenty-five years feels right in my bones and feels right in my spirit,” she said.

In addition to a great television show among other things, Oprah has her outstanding book club. Oprah’s book club has been around since 1996. Oprah’s book club has introduced many books that may not have been noticed by the majority of readers.

Winfrey offered no specifics about her plans for the future, except to say that she intended to produce the best possible shows during her last 18 months on the air. Many fans heading into Harpo Studios on Friday morning seemed to support Winfrey’s decision.

Smallville Review

“Smallville” set a record in its first episode, drawing 8.4 million viewers to its story of young Superman (the largest audience ever recorded for the Warner Brothers network). The show follows young Clark Kent through his high school years in small-town America, sustaining interest in the future Superman with good acting and good stories.

“Smallville” succeeds because its actors create compelling characters, highlighting the personal struggles of the future hero rather than his uniform and superpowers. From the very first episode Clark finds emotional struggles, knowing that the meteor which brought him to earth also killed the parents of Lana Lang.

Lex’s character creates much of the show’s conflict, suspiciously eying his friend Clark for signs of his superpowers. But there’s another interesting wrinkle. Lex must also deal with difficult father Lionel, a ruthless businessman. Lionel’s machinations lend additional tension to the show.

Lana Lang, who was portrayed as “the girl who had a crush on Clark” in the comics has a pivotal role in Clark’s rise to Superman on Smallville. With the chemistry the two display on screen, it’s as tragic as a Shakesperean drama to watch two characters who are madly in love with one another and know that they’re ultimately not meant to be.

Grey’s Anatomy Season 6 Premiere

On Thursday September 24, 2009 the long awaited season premiere of Grey’s Anatomy finally premiered. Last season audiences were left with the most shocking cliff hanger of all five seasons: The death of either George O’Malley or Izzie Stevens! Unfortunately the inevitable happened when George O’Malley died.

Rumor has been circulating since last year that the actor who plays George is unhappy and wants off the show. After the infamous Isiah Washington scandal a rift that was never mended was created between T.R Knight and show creator Shonda Rhimes. Katherine Heigl who also plays Izzie Stevens is rumored to want off the show as well. She infamously chose to not submit her name for an Emmy nomination last year saying the writing did not merit an Emmy nomination. Naturally this was a slap in the face to the show writers. But regardless, the show did not grant her wish. Many speculate it’s because she is a box office star and can still bring in viewers.

Heroes Review

NBC’s hit new series, Heroes, follows the stories of several average people that discover they have unusual abilities. Although it sounds clich at first, it is a very captivating show because it is so easy to relate to the characters. They may have superpowers but they certainly aren’t perfect, and that makes them feel very real and very human. It’s their flaws and confusion over what is happening to them that really draws you into the experience.

Not only does each story feel up close and personal, there are so many main characters that there’s bound to be one that you can relate to. In a TV world dominated by occupation-specific shows such as CSI or House it is rare to find a show with such a broad range of roles. It is interesting to see how differently a politician and an artist each react to the discovery of a personal superpower. And despite the fact that the plot branches out to follow each character, all the stories are continuously being interwoven. It’s even fun to speculate who will cross paths next and how it will happen.

Supernatural TV Series Review

It all started by taking the brothers, Dean and Sam Winchester, out investigating urban legends that we have all heard of and wondered about. From there it evolved into finding the demon responsible for killing their mother, all with a few plot twists thrown in, such as finding out several children born on the same day were intentionally given powers by the demon for a sinister purpose. Sam is one of those children.

This show is full of action and characterization. It combines both to great effect so not only does it keep you on the edge of your seat but you really care about what happens to the characters. The family dynamic and the interaction between the two brothers and how each one relates to his father is some of the best character interaction you’ll see on TV.

So, what’s to like about Supernatural? What’s not to like. Brother’s who bicker and love each other just like all siblings everywhere. The war being fought between Good and evil at the supernatural level and everything in between. Characters you can really identify with battling the war within, just like the rest of us do day in and day out. This is a show you don’t want to miss. Entertainment with substance.
